about us

OUR GOALS

To combat the shortage of PPE in our local hospitals and clinics, Students for Hospitals—a team of Bay Area high school and college students—designed a protective face shield to support our healthcare workers. Utilizing student volunteers and inexpensive materials, we produce and donate face shields to hospitals, clinics, homeless shelters and more. In the future, we hope to expand our impact by recruiting more volunteers, and raising more funds to further aid our community. 


WHO WE'VE WORKED WITH

Though we began by donating solely to hospitals, our efforts have expanded to also help smaller clinics and homeless shelters:

  • Kaiser Permanente
  • Good Samaritan Hospital
  • Gardner Clinic
  • Saratoga Pediatrics
  • Santa Clara Valley Medical Center
  • Green Hills Manor
  • San Tomas Convalescent Hospital
  • Cupertino Healthcare & Wellness
  • Angles Senior Union Home
  • Chateau Cupertino
  • Sequoia Hospital
